I''d like to thank everyone on this board. I''ve lurked on here for a few months and finally after reading many postings on here, I went ahead and made my very informed purchase.
I decided on getting an Asscher stone and thankfully I learned a lot about Asscher stones what the right specs should, at least for my budget.
I ended up purchasing my diamond from USACerted Diamonds (Martin Sheffield) and I believe I got a great price for a great stone. Martin was very helpful and absolutely trustworthy. I was so nervous about purchasing a stone over the internet sight unseen but it was all for naught. The stone was legit and Martin walked me through all of it at his office. I then had the stone & GIA certificate verified by GEMSCAN in Toronto. I now recommend Martin to all my friends and family. Even my brother who has a "wholesaler friend" couldn''t get a better price than me (in fact, I think he might call Martin for an upgrade for his wife''s stone).
The ring setting was custom made by P & H Design in Toronto where I dealt with Howard Hofland. He was of great assistance as picking out the setting was much more difficult than picking out a stone. In the end, I ended up with a Tacori design that P & H made in Platinum and it all worked out beautifully.
The specs are as follows:
Center Stone:
CTW = 1.01 Square Emerald Cut (AKA Asscher Cut)
Clarity = VS-2
Colour = F
Polish/Symmetry = Excellent/Very Good
Fluorescence = None
Table/Depth = 65% / 69.6%
Side Stones:
CTW = 0.51 (14 Princess Cut - 0.30 CTW & 28 Round Brilliant - 0.21 CTS)
Clarity = VS-1 / SI-1
Colour = F/G
Cut = Good
Ring itself was 6.36 GRams of Platinum.
